Shools nighl scenes wilh less noise and
blur withoul using a lripod. A burst of
shots are laken, and image processing
is applied lo reduce subjecl blur,
camera shake, and noise.
• Reducing blur is less efflzctive even in [Hand-held
Twilight]
when shooting:
- Subjects with erratic movement
- Subjects are too close to the camera
Subjects with a repeating pattern such as tiles, and
subjects with little contrast such as sky, sandy beach, or
lawn
Subjects with constant change such as waves or water
falls
• lu the case of [Hand-held Twilight], block noise may occur
when using a light source that flickers, such as fluorescent
lighting.
